Craig Finn

Craig A. Finn (born August 22, 1971) is an American singer-songwriter and musician. He is best known as the frontman of the American indie rock band The Hold Steady, with whom he has recorded nine studio albums. Prior to forming The Hold Steady, Finn was the frontman of Lifter Puller. Described by Pitchfork as "a born storyteller who's chosen rock as his medium," Finn has released five solo albums : Clear Heart Full Eyes (2012), Faith in the Future (2015), We All Want the Same Things (2017), I Need a New War (2019) and A Legacy of Rentals (2022). Finn began hosting his own podcast, That's How I Remember It, in 2022. In the podcast he examines the relationship between memory and creativity through interviews with other artists.
